changelog
- Tue, 12 Mar 2013 16:02:43 +0000
- by mcimadamore [Tue, 12 Mar 2013 16:02:43 +0000] rev 1628
- 8009545: Graph inference: dependencies between inference variables should be set during incorporation
Summary: Move all transitivity checks into the incorporation round
Reviewed-by: jjg
- Tue, 12 Mar 2013 16:02:13 +0000
- by mcimadamore [Tue, 12 Mar 2013 16:02:13 +0000] rev 1627
- 8008540: Constructor reference to non-reifiable array should be rejected
8008539: Spurious error when constructor reference mention an interface type
8008538: Constructor reference accepts wildcard parameterized types
Summary: Overhaul of Check.checkConstructorRefType
Reviewed-by: jjg
- Tue, 12 Mar 2013 11:16:30 +0100
- by jfranck [Tue, 12 Mar 2013 11:16:30 +0100] rev 1626
- 8005205: tests missing bugid for repeating annotation change
Reviewed-by: jjg, ssides
- Mon, 11 Mar 2013 19:03:35 -0700
- by ohrstrom [Mon, 11 Mar 2013 19:03:35 -0700] rev 1625
- 8009843: sjavac should accept -cp as synonym for -classpath
Reviewed-by: jjg
- Mon, 11 Mar 2013 10:02:55 -0700
- by rfield [Mon, 11 Mar 2013 10:02:55 -0700] rev 1624
- 8009742: Bad lambda name for lambda in a static initializer or ctor
Reviewed-by: mcimadamore
- Mon, 11 Mar 2013 15:35:13 +0000
- by vromero [Mon, 11 Mar 2013 15:35:13 +0000] rev 1623
- 6181889: Empty try/finally results in bytecodes being generated
Reviewed-by: mcimadamore
- Thu, 07 Mar 2013 08:26:13 -0800
- by rfield [Thu, 07 Mar 2013 08:26:13 -0800] rev 1622
- 8009582: Method reference generic constructor gives: IllegalArgumentException: Invalid lambda deserialization
Reviewed-by: mcimadamore
- Thu, 07 Mar 2013 10:12:13 +0000
- by vromero [Thu, 07 Mar 2013 10:12:13 +0000] rev 1621
- 8009170: Regression: javac generates redundant bytecode in assignop involving arrays
Reviewed-by: mcimadamore
- Thu, 07 Mar 2013 10:04:28 +0000
- by vromero [Thu, 07 Mar 2013 10:04:28 +0000] rev 1620
- 8009138: javac, equals-hashCode warning tuning
Reviewed-by: mcimadamore
- Wed, 06 Mar 2013 15:33:39 +0000
- by mcimadamore [Wed, 06 Mar 2013 15:33:39 +0000] rev 1619
- 8009391: Synthetic name of serializable lambda methods should not contain negative numbers
Summary: Use hex representation of method signature hashcode to avoid negative numbers
Reviewed-by: jjg